The Washington Nationals broke in the new ballpark with an exciting win as Ryan Zimmerman hit a walkoff homerun to give the Nationals the 3-2 victory over the Atlanta Braves.

Nick Johnson got the team off to a good start in the first inning as he doubled in Christian GuzmanAustin Kearns then singled to right field that scored Johnson.  Those were the only two runs the Nationals got until Zimmerman ended the game with two outs in the ninth inning.

Jon Rauch picked up the win for the Nationals.  Odalis Perez was the starting pitcher and lasted five innings, giving up four hits and one earned run.  He did serve up a gopher ball to Chipper Jones, that was pretty much his only mistake of the ballgame.

The Nationals will now take on the Philadelphia Phillies as they try to move to 2-0 on the 2008 season.

The Washington Nationals have made another round of cuts as they trim down their spring training roster as it gets closer to opening day.

Chris Schroder and John Lannan were optioned to Triple-A Columbus.

Ryan Langerhans and Pete Orr were sent to the teams minor league camp.

John Patterson, who many people thought would be the opening day starter for the Washington Nationals was released today by the team.  The lack of velocity Patterson has shown all spring training, was the main reason for his release reports are saying.

What do you think abou this Nationals fans?  The team will only save around $600,000 by releasing him.  I think it is a very big suprise and not sure if I would have done it when you look at the rest of the pitching rotation.
